Quote:
Originally Posted by PieOPah View Post
What is the best format that the reader takes? I understand that it can cope with a number of formats, but I would assume that it handles each differently.
The LRF format is the best for the reader. However, some say ePub is better... depends on who you talk to.

Quote:
Originally Posted by PieOPah View Post
Looking at the prices of E-books, waterstones seems quite expensive. Would there be any problem purchasing from some of the US websites which seem to have a much cheaper cost?
Problem? No. However, you will probably need to strip the DRM in order to convert and use on the Sony. However, this is pretty easy to do. Most popular stores seem to be fictionwise.com and booksonboard.com.

Quote:
Originally Posted by PieOPah View Post
How simple is it to convert some of the public domain e-books to the best format?
Once again pretty easy. Also, many sites already have the LRF and/or ePub formats so no conversion would be needed.
